Resolution 25-27 Display&Sales of Storage Sheds at 1942 US Hwy 8

A RESOLUTION GRANTING A SPECIAL EXCEPTION

TO TIMOTHY CROFT/DAKOTA STORAGE BUILDINGS FOR DISPLAY AND SALES OF STORAGE SHEDS IN THE COMMERCIAL DISTRICT

WHEREAS Timothy Croft/Dakota Storage Sheds, lessee of property owned by R&D Rental Properties has filed an application with the Town of St. Croix Falls for the display and sales of storage sheds at 1942 US Highway 8, located in the NW ¼ of NE ¼ of Section 35, T34N, R18W, and identified as Tax Parcel #044-00965-0000; and

WHEREAS Chapter III, Section C, 3. Commercial District, c. 18 – requires as special exception for retail of storage sheds, mobile homes, manufactured homes and modular homes provided a permanent structure for retail sales and business is located on the property; and

WHEREAS per Chapter I, Section I, 3, (b) the Plan Commission did conduct a public hearing on the matter and did recommend approval on July 9, 2025, for the special exception with conditions for display and sales of storage sheds at 1942 US Highway 8, located in the NW ¼ of NE ¼ of Section 35.

THEREFORE BE IT RESOLVED that the Town Board of the Town of St. Croix Falls, Polk County, Wisconsin, does hereby concur with the Town Plan Commission to grant a special exception to Timothy Croft/Dakota Storage Buildings for the display and sales of storage sheds at 1942 US Highway 8 in the NW ¼ of NE ¼ of Section 35 and identified as tax parcel number #044-00965-0000 subject to the following conditions:

  • No storage sheds shall be displayed in the road right of way;
  • There shall be no office space for sales/business in sheds;
  • Signage shall be added to existing ground sign not to exceed a total of 100 square feet per Town’s Zoning Ordinance No. 1, Chapter V, Section L, 2. b.;
  • The special exception shall terminate upon the sale or transfer of ownership of either the parcel of land or the business itself;
  • Any formal complaint lodged against the use in the first year of operation will lead to an automatic review of the special exception by the plan commission and/or town board at the next possible meeting; and
  • The business will obey all laws and maintain all proper licenses and permits.

BE IT FURETHER RESOLVED that this resolution replaces Resolution 25-16 and Resolution 25-16 is hereby revoked; and

B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that this special exception is conditioned on the applicants obtaining the necessary and required permits, if any, from Polk County and various agencies of the State of Wisconsin; and

B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that this special exception must be exercised by application for necessary permits, if any, or business activity as approved within twelve (12) months of the date of this Resolution.

Dated this 16th day of July, 2025
